NO BENCH RACING! You wanna know how fast your car is in the 1/4 mile? Go to the track and race it. Wether you can drag the car good or not is going to affect your time. Weather is going to affect your time. The condition of your motor and how its performing is going to affect your time. Your mods to the motor are going to affect your time. The weight of your car is going to affect your time. If your suspension isnt alligned right, it will affect your time! The tires you are using will affect your time. Tire pressure, tire compound, tire size will affect your time. In other words...

If you wanna know how fast your car is, GO TO THE TRACK! THEN, come back here and tell us what it ran and how the car is set up, then we MAY be able to help you reduce your times with some advice. Again, bench racing is NOT allowed in this forum!
